Context: What the CLARITY Act Actually Does

The CLARITY Act (Crypto Legislative and Regulatory Integrity for Tomorrow Act) aims to establish a federal framework for digital assets, clarify oversight between SEC and CFTC, and integrate crypto into the U.S. financial system. It passed the House with bipartisan support, but the Senate version has ballooned to 300 pages after 11 months of negotiations. The core sticking point: ethics provisions restricting government officials' financial interests in crypto. Democrats want stricter rules — full divestment, no trading, and stronger enforcement powers for state attorneys general. Republicans, led by Senator Cynthia Lummis, argue the bill is already over-negotiated and should just go to a vote. Senator Thom Tillis said the delay has "possibly dropped" the passage chance by 50%.

Core: The $200 Million Elephant in the Room

Let's talk about the data that matters. Fairshake, the crypto industry's main PAC, held nearly $200 million in cash reserves at the start of this cycle. That's not a lobbying fund — that's a war chest designed to influence the 2026 midterm elections. The crypto industry had hoped the Senate would at least advance procedural votes before the summer recess, allowing them to adjust political spending based on legislative progress. But the delay forces a shift: instead of funding candidates who support the CLARITY Act, the money will now flow to attack ads against opponents.

I've seen this playbook before. In 2022, after the Terra collapse, the industry threw money at pro-crypto candidates in swing states. This time, the stakes are higher. The CLARITY Act's delay means the window for federal regulation closes before the election cycle heats up. That pushes enforcement to the state level — New York's BitLicense, Texas's crypto banking laws, California's digital asset disclosure rules. Smart money is already rebalancing portfolios to account for state-level fragmentation.
